Beluga Lookout is a hidden treasure right out in the open. If you enjoy wildlife, camping near water, open skies and fresh air, Beluga Lookout is a must-see. My parents and I decided to visit this park for the obvious - in the hopes of catching sight of a Beluga whale. What we experienced was so much more than we hoped for! We saw the whales, caribou, seals and even an eagle. We pulled in to this site not expecting much more entertainment than the wildlife (which would have been worth it as it is) but we soon found out there was a whole host of things to do. From bike rentals to a golf course, this park was a wonderful surprise. It was such a charming experience for my family and I recommend you make it one for yours, too. - Review provided by RV Park Recommendations & Reviews Facebook Group
